註釋
Lucky Cat
is a heartwarming story about an immigrant family in America, and a new friend their daughter June makes as they prepare to open their restaurant.
June's family have a new home in America. There’s plenty to do before their restaurant opens, but Mama is excited when she finds
the previous owners have left a Lucky Cat
! It’s meant to bring good luck to their ventures, and June is even more excited the next evening when she finds that
the statue can come to life
.
But
unfortunately, Lucky Cat doesn’t seem that lucky
. She has the best intentions but she knocks over the vinegar bottle and rips holes in people’s clothing. Will she ever get anything right? Luckily, June learns that
real luck is earned through hard work and perseverance
as the family embark on a new venture, close to their hearts.
